Choose the correct statements from the following: (A) Ethane-1,2-diamine is a chelating ligand. (B) Metallic aluminium is produced by electrolysis of aluminium oxide in presence of cryolite. (C) Cyanide ion is used as ligand for leaching of silver. (D) Phosphine acts as a ligand in Wilkinson catalyst. (E) The stability constants of Ca2+Ca^{2+} and Mg2+Mg^{2+} are similar with EDTA complexes.

  • A

    (B), (C), (E) only

  • B

    (A), (B), (C) only

  • C

    (B), (C), (D), (E) only

  • D

    (A), (B), (C), (D), (E)

Answer

Correct answer:B

Step-by-step solution

Standard Method

Given: Five statements about coordination chemistry and metallurgy are to be checked individually.

Find: The option containing all correct statements.

Statement (A): Ethane-1,2-diamine (ethylenediamine, en) has two donor nitrogen atoms and acts as a bidentate ligand. Hence it is a chelating ligand. So (A) is correct.

Statement (B): Aluminium is produced industrially by electrolysis of aluminium oxide dissolved in cryolite in the Hall-H\u00e9roult process. So (B) is correct.

Statement (C): In the cyanide process, silver forms the soluble complex [Ag(CN)2][Ag(CN)_2]^-, so cyanide ion acts as a ligand during leaching. So (C) is correct.

Statement (D): Wilkinson catalyst contains triphenylphosphine ligand P(C6H5)3P(C_6H_5)_3, not phosphine PH3PH_3. So (D) is incorrect.

Statement (E): The EDTA complexes of Ca2+Ca^{2+} and Mg2+Mg^{2+} do not have similar stability constants; they differ significantly. So (E) is incorrect.

Therefore, the correct statements are (A), (B), and (C).

Among the given options, this corresponds to option B.

Common mistakes

  • Confusing phosphine PH3PH_3 with triphenylphosphine P(C6H5)3P(C_6H_5)_3 in Wilkinson catalyst. These are different ligands; read the catalyst composition carefully before judging statement (D).

  • Assuming all EDTA complexes have similar stability. The stability constants depend on the metal ion, so Ca2+Ca^{2+} and Mg2+Mg^{2+} do not form equally stable EDTA complexes; compare their relative complex stability instead of generalising.

  • Missing that ethane-1,2-diamine is bidentate. A ligand with two donor atoms can bind through both sites and form a chelate ring, so statement (A) should not be marked false.
